This one I may come to regret selling last month - a Bamford PVD chrono from the very same Bamford that customises Rolexes (starting at around £10k)! When George Bamford opened his store on Sloane Square in 2009, these were made available at £275 in limited numbers - only found out via Octane magazine and went straight there as the colour combi was something different and I was after a PVD chrono. The movement was, I believe a Miyota. Really well constructed and unusual with the pale blue. Turned heads (and some stomachs) when the baby blue ostrich strap was fitted!
